Procurement Report: Game Costumes & Cosplay Apparel

Product Category: Game Costumes / Cosplay Apparel Market Context: B2B Manufacturing and Export (Southeast Asia to EU/US)

1. Technical Specifications and Performance Metrics

Game costumes require a balance of visual fidelity, durability, and wearability. Unlike standard apparel, these items often involve complex structural engineering to mimic in-game assets.

  • Material Composition:
    • Base Fabrics: High-density polyester (300D–600D) for durability; EVA foam (1mm–10mm thickness) for armor plating; PVC or PU leather for accents.
    • Textile Safety: Fabrics must meet OEKO-TEX Standard 100 criteria for chemical safety, ensuring no harmful dyes or formaldehyde residues.
    • Inferred Range: Typical B2B range for fabric GSM (grams per square meter) is 180–350 GSM for outer layers to balance weight and opacity.
  • Structural Integrity:
    • Seam Strength: Double-stitched or reinforced bar-tacked seams to withstand dynamic movement.
    • Durability: Expected lifespan of 20–50 wear cycles for mass-market items; 100+ cycles for high-fidelity custom pieces if maintained.
    • Weight Distribution: Armor components should not exceed 15–20% of the total costume weight to prevent user fatigue during long events.
  • Sizing & Fit:
    • Sizing Tolerance: Standard deviation of ±2.5 cm in key measurements (chest, waist, height) is typical for mass production.
    • Adjustability: Inclusion of Velcro, elastic, or lacing systems to accommodate a ±10% variance in user body measurements.

Actionable Recommendation: Prioritize suppliers who provide physical samples for "stress testing" (movement simulation) before finalizing orders. Request material data sheets confirming flame retardancy if the costume is intended for indoor stage use or events with strict fire codes.

2. Industry Compliance and Quality Assurance

Compliance is a mandatory pillar for exporting game costumes to the EU and US markets. Failure to meet these standards results in customs seizure or liability issues.

  • Certification Frameworks:
    • EU Market: CE marking is required for general safety. If the costume is marketed as a "toy" (e.g., for children under 14), EN71 toy safety standards apply. OEKO-TEX Standard 100 is the industry benchmark for textile chemical safety.
    • US Market: Consumer Product Certificate (CPC) is mandatory for children's items. Prop65 compliance is critical for California sales, requiring warnings for specific chemicals (e.g., lead, phthalates) if present.
  • Quality Control (QC) Metrics:
    • Defect Rate: Acceptable defect rate (AQL) for mass production is typically 2.5% for major defects (e.g., missing parts, severe dye bleeding) and 4.0% for minor defects.
    • Common Failure Points: Negative reviews cluster around seam failures, dye transfer, and sizing inaccuracies.
    • Inspection Frequency: Third-party inspections should be conducted at 30% (pre-production), 50% (during production), and 100% (pre-shipment) for high-fidelity orders.

Actionable Recommendation: Do not over-certify early. Validate product-market fit with a pilot batch before investing in a full suite of certifications. However, ensure the factory has the capability to generate CPC and OEKO-TEX reports immediately upon order confirmation to avoid supply chain delays.

3. Cost Efficiency and Integration Capabilities

Cost structures vary significantly based on fidelity and production volume. Logistics and duties are non-negligible factors in the final landed cost.

  • Cost of Goods Sold (COGS) Benchmarks:
    • Mass-Market: Under USD 20 per unit. Focus on simple fabrics and minimal hardware.
    • Mid-Tier: USD 20 – USD 150 per unit. Includes better materials, custom molding, and more complex assembly.
    • High-Fidelity/Game Costumes: USD 150 – USD 1,000+ per unit. Involves hand-painting, custom 3D printing, and premium materials.
  • Logistics & Duties:
    • Add-on Costs: Logistics and import duties typically add 10–30% to the factory cost.
    • MOQ (Minimum Order Quantity): Typical B2B range is 50–100 units for mid-tier; 500+ units for mass-market to achieve optimal pricing.
    • Lead Time: Standard production lead time is 30–45 days. High-fidelity custom orders may require 60–90 days.
  • Integration Capabilities:
    • Modularity: Costumes should be designed with modular components (e.g., detachable wings, interchangeable armor plates) to reduce shipping volume and allow for future upgrades.

Actionable Recommendation: Calculate the "Landed Cost" (Factory Cost + 15% avg. logistics/duties) before negotiating. For high-fidelity items, consider a hybrid model: mass-produce the base suit (low COGS) and outsource custom armor painting to specialized local artisans to manage costs without sacrificing quality.

4. Typical Use Cases

Understanding the end-user environment is crucial for specifying durability and safety requirements.

  • Conventions & Comic Cons: High traffic, long duration (8+ hours), and high visibility. Requires breathable fabrics and comfortable fit.
  • Theatrical & Stage Performance: Requires flame-retardant materials (if applicable) and high-impact durability for choreography.
  • Retail & E-Commerce: Sold as "ready-to-wear" or DIY kits. Requires clear sizing charts and easy assembly instructions.
  • Promotional & Branding: Custom logos or character skins for marketing events. Focus on brand visibility over long-term durability.
  • Children's Play: Must strictly adhere to EN71 and CPC standards, with no small detachable parts that pose choking hazards.

Actionable Recommendation: Segment your procurement strategy by use case. For convention wear, prioritize comfort and breathability (mesh linings). For retail, prioritize packaging and sizing accuracy to minimize return rates.

5. Long-Term Planning Considerations

Strategic planning must account for market volatility, regulatory changes, and consumer sentiment.

  • Market Trends & Demand Signals:
    • IP Licensing: Demand is shifting toward officially licensed IPs. Unlicensed costumes face higher legal risks but lower entry barriers.
    • Sustainability: Growing demand for recycled polyester and eco-friendly packaging.
    • Customization: Buyers increasingly prefer "semi-custom" options (e.g., choice of color, size) over rigid mass-produced SKUs.
  • Regulatory Evolution:
    • Chemical Regulations: Expect stricter Prop65 and EU REACH updates. Proactive testing for emerging chemicals is advised.
    • Toy vs. Apparel: The line between "costume" and "toy" is blurring. If a costume includes interactive elements (lights, sound), it may trigger stricter toy safety regulations.
  • Supply Chain Resilience:
    • Diversify suppliers across different regions (e.g., Vietnam, China, India) to mitigate geopolitical or logistical disruptions.

Actionable Recommendation: Build a "Compliance Buffer" into your budget (5–10%) for future regulatory upgrades. Start relationships with suppliers who offer flexible MOQs to test new IP trends without over-committing inventory.

7. Frequently Asked Questions (FAQ)

Q1: What is the typical lead time for a high-fidelity game costume order? A: For high-fidelity costumes involving custom molding and hand-painting, expect a lead time of 60–90 days. Mass-market items typically require 30–45 days.

Q2: Are OEKO-TEX and CE markings mandatory for all game costumes? A: CE marking is mandatory for EU market access. OEKO-TEX is not legally mandatory but is a critical industry standard for textile safety and buyer trust. CPC is mandatory for children's items in the US.

Q3: How much do logistics and duties typically add to the factory cost? A: Logistics and import duties generally add 10–30% to the factory cost (COGS), depending on the destination country and shipping method.

Q4: What are the most common reasons for negative reviews in this category? A: Negative reviews typically cluster around seam failures, dye bleeding onto skin/clothes, and inaccurate sizing. Addressing these proactively is more cost-effective than handling returns.

Q5: Can I start with a small order to test the market before getting full certifications? A: Yes. It is recommended to validate product-market fit with a pilot batch (e.g., 50 units) before investing in a full suite of certifications, which ties up capital. However, ensure the factory can provide the necessary documentation upon scaling.

Q6: What is the acceptable defect rate for B2B orders? A: A typical AQL (Acceptable Quality Limit) for major defects is 2.5%, and 4.0% for minor defects. Anything above this usually results in batch rejection.

Q7: How does the cost structure differ between mid-tier and high-fidelity costumes? A: Mid-tier costumes range from USD 20 to USD 150 per unit, focusing on standard materials. High-fidelity costumes range from USD 150 to USD 1,000+ per unit, utilizing premium materials, custom engineering, and labor-intensive finishing.

Q8: What materials are best for armor components in game costumes? A: EVA foam (1mm–10mm thickness) is the industry standard for lightweight armor. PVC or PU leather is used for accents, while high-density polyester is used for the base fabric.
